17、is document is ISO/TC 254, Safety of amusement rides and amusement devices.iv ISO 2014 All rights reserved PD ISO/TS 17929:2014 ISO/TS 17929:2014(E) Introduction Most passenger-carrying devices, e.g. vehicles, transport systems, elevators, cableways, and other similar structures, are deliberately de
18、signed to minimize biomechanical effects on passengers. Amusement rides are different in that the biomechanical effects are deliberately introduced in order to amuse people through stimulation of their sensory system. Thus, in addition to mechanical, electrical and other hazards, amusement rides cou
19、ld feature significant biomechanical hazards for passengers. Passengers being moved by amusement rides are subject to inertia forces. The magnitude, direction, duration of exposure to, and rate of change of, these forces could create risks that need to be minimized. The risks may be increased by the
20、 use of entertaining effects. Design of the amusement ride in accordance with this Technical Specification, together with ISO 17842, minimizes any risks from these biomechanical effects. When it is important for safety reasons, passenger weight, height, and age also need to be considered. Moreover,
21、amusement ride passengers can have different states of health or well-being during a ride cycle and there is a probability of injury not due to any amusement ride defect but owing to the individual health state of a passenger. When a designer, manufacturer or operator provides a warning before the r
22、ide entrance for guests, making them aware of ride use restrictions considering their state of health (see Annex D), this can limit legal liability for possible harm to passengers in poor health.
